Backlash 2002 was a professional wrestling pay-per-view event produced by the World Wrestling Federation (WWF) promotion, which took place on April 21, 2002 at Kemper Arena in Kansas City, Missouri. The event starred talent from the Raw and SmackDown! brands. It was the fourth event under the Backlash chronology, the third consecutive Backlash presented by Castrol GTX and the final U.S.-produced pay-per-view to use the WWF name. This was the first WWF pay-per-view event after the Brand Extension. The last time a WWF Pay Per View was held in Kemper Arena was WWF Over The Edge 1999, in which Owen Hart, competing as the Blue Blazer, fell 78 feet to his death from a harness during his ring entrance. Nine professional wrestling matches were scheduled on the event's card
